Crawlspace waterproofing services involve installing systems and barriers designed to prevent water intrusion beneath a building. These services typically include the application of vapor barriers, installation of sump pumps, and sealing of foundation cracks to keep moisture out of the crawlspace. Proper waterproofing helps to create a dry environment that reduces the risk of water damage, mold growth, and structural deterioration. By addressing moisture issues at the source, these services aim to improve indoor air quality and protect the overall integrity of the property.
Water infiltration in crawlspaces can lead to a range of problems, including mold development, wood rot, and increased humidity levels. Excess moisture often attracts pests and can cause damage to insulation and electrical systems. Waterproofing services are designed to mitigate these issues by controlling water flow and eliminating sources of leaks. This proactive approach helps homeowners and property managers avoid costly repairs and health concerns associated with persistent dampness and mold proliferation.

Cost Range - Crawlspace waterproofing typically costs between $1,500 and $4,000, depending on the size and extent of the project. For example, a small crawlspace in Northville, MI might be around $1,800, while larger areas could reach $4,000 or more.
Factors Affecting Price - Prices vary based on the type of waterproofing system installed, such as interior or exterior measures. Additional work like sump pump installation or drainage improvements can increase costs, often adding $500 to $2,000.
Average Expenses - On average, homeowners pay approximately $2,500 for comprehensive crawlspace waterproofing services. This includes sealing, drainage, and moisture control measures provided by local service providers.
Cost Variability - Costs can fluctuate depending on the condition of the crawlspace and accessibility, with some projects costing as low as $1,200 and others exceeding $5,000. Contact local pros to get a detailed estimate tailored to spec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is crawlspace waterproofing? Crawlspace waterproofing involves measures taken by local service providers to prevent water intrusion and moisture buildup in crawlspaces, helping to protect the home's foundation and indoor air quality.
Why is waterproofing a crawlspace important? Proper waterproofing can help reduce mold growth, prevent wood rot, and avoid structural damage caused by excess moisture and water leaks.
What methods are used for crawlspace waterproofing? Common approaches include installing vapor barriers, improving drainage, sealing cracks, and adding sump pumps, with local pros advising on the best options for each situation.
How can I tell if my crawlspace needs waterproofing? Signs include damp or musty odors, standing water, mold growth, or visible water stains on the foundation walls, prompting a consultation with local waterproofing specialists.
